Output 8773583d273dc01c3a7bcbf9554d2bb9e8bac990b06f8a583d0ec478f0a24117:15

value
984094329
script pubkey
OP_0 OP_PUSHBYTES_32 faf9a97df38fd1bee329ecd295a330872c2a3ca3bb10bb7c6e0f73278f75a8c5
address
bc1qltu6jl0n3lgmacefanfftgessukz509rhvgtklrwpaej0rm44rzsnx069f
transaction
8773583d273dc01c3a7bcbf9554d2bb9e8bac990b06f8a583d0ec478f0a24117
spent
true